HCONRES 109 · 119th CongressPassed Housecongress.gov ↗

Allowing Emancipation Hall to be used for a ceremony to dedicate the Semiquincentennial Congressional Time Capsule on Wednesday, June 24, 2026.

This bill would allow Emancipation Hall, a large room in the U.S. Capitol Visitor Center, to be used for a ceremony on June 24, 2026, to dedicate a time capsule related to the Semiquincentennial, which is the 250th anniversary of the United States. No official summary is available for this bill.
